Thank you for answering, I just want to be sure, now I have an install script with 2 choices: snow leopard choice requirement asks for the target OS >= 10.6 leopard choice requirement asks for the target OS < 10.6 If I create an easy install with such a configuration, it will install show version on snow leopard and leopard version on leopard? I thought PM can provide requirements for choices only in case of custom installation. Please confirm. If this the case, that I just have missed the point... I have a working installer with choices and custom installation type, but never tried to build it as easy install only Thanks a lot! AFAIK, when you enable the Easy/Standard Install only option, it is just a UI trick to prevent the user from accessing the Custom Install mode. It does not prevent requirements from being evaluated.
